About Lombardy

Lombardy, located in northern Italy, is known for its rich history, vibrant culture, and stunning landscapes. It is home to the fashion capital of Milan, as well as the picturesque lakes of Como and Garda, making it a diverse and appealing destination for all types of travelers.

Must-Try Local Dishes

Risotto alla Milanese

Creamy saffron risotto, a signature dish of Milan.

Dinner Contains dairy

Ossobuco

Braised veal shanks, often served with gremolata.

Dinner Contains meat

Cotoletta alla Milanese

Breaded and fried veal cutlet, similar to schnitzel.

Dinner Contains meat and gluten

Panettone

A sweet bread loaf with raisins and candied fruit, traditionally served at Christmas.
